Located in southern Africa,Namibia is a country that boats a unique blend of stunning landscapes,diverse wildlife,and rich cultural heritage,making it an attractive destination for tourists.With its well developed tourism infrastructure,Namibia offers a wide range of exciting experiences for visitors from around the world.

One of the main attractions in Namibia is the Etosha national park, a UNESCO world heritage site and one of the largest game reserves in Africa. The park is home to an incredible array of wildlife,including the Big five(lion,elephant,buffalo,leopard,and rhinoceros) as well as cheetahs, hyenas,and giraffe. Visitors can enjoy guided safaris, game drives, and scenic flights over the park,providing unparalleled opportunities to witness the majesty of Africa’s wildlife.

Another population destination in Namibia is the skeleton coast, a rugged and dramatic coastline that stretches for over 500 kilometers.The coast is characterized by its unique rock formations,shipwrecks,and vast expanses of untouched beaches. Visitors can take a scenic drive along the coast, go hiking, or engage in water sports such as surfing and kayaking.

In addition to its natural beauty,Namibia is also rich in cultural heritage.The country is home to over 20 different ethnic groups,each with its own unique customs and traditions.Visitors can experience the vibrant culture of Namibia by visiting traditional villages,attending cultural festivals,or taking part in guided tours of historic sites such as the Namibia Desert and the Fish River Canyon.

According to the Namibia Tourism Board, the country welcomed over 1.5 million tourists in 2020,generating over N15billion in revenue. The tourism industry is a significant contributor to Namibia’s economy, creating jobs and stimulating local economic growth.
